		<description><![CDATA[A few years ago, we sent a robot to Bluejacket-Flint Elementary so that the students could experience what we create first hand. Plyaq&#8217;s week-long visit led up to each of the kids making their own robot sculpture out of found materials.

Four robots have been training for the biggest run of their short little lives. This Thursday, February 24, will be the first robot marathon held in Osaka. It will take the bots four days to make it around the course a total of 422 times.
